The Body Shop Sells Most of Its European and Asian Businesses
According to reports, The Body Shop is preparing to sell most of its business in Europe and part of its business in Asia, which includes physical and digital channels, accounting for about 14% of The Body Shop's global business.
The troubled beauty brand said in a statement that the sale would not impact its operations in the UK market, "This further prioritizes The Body Shop's strategically important markets and global lead franchise partnerships and will look for opportunities to build on these relationships. The Body Shop will also work to strengthen its digital platform, develop new sales channels and differentiated retail experiences to attract customers more effectively."
The spokesman added that the sale of the European and Asian operations would allow it to strengthen its presence in other key markets, "Our ambition is to create a modern and dynamic beauty brand that is relevant to customers and able to compete in the long term. The Body Shop must continue to create great products, rediscover its unique strengths, and achieve financial stability."
Previously, Natura & Co sold The Body Shop in September 2023, and investor Aurelius Group bought it for £207 million in November.
